Gardai are appealing for information following a burglary at the Venice of Ireland Tavern on Main Street in Monasterevin.
The incident occurred on Monday the 12th of December at 2:15am, whereby 2 males entered the property through forcing the rear kitchen door.
The males stole a sum of cash from the premises and exited through the rear kitchen door.
Gardai are appealing for witnesses and anyone with information is asked to contact Monastervein Garda Station.
